What companies run services between Wealdstone, England and Central Middlesex Hospital,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Harrow & Wealdstone station to Harlesden station every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£5–18 and the journey takes 13 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Harrow & Wealdstone Station to Central Middlesex Hospital via Wembley Stadium and Central Middlesex Hospital in around 56 min.
